XSLT, 2-е издание (файл PDF)

XSLT, 2-е издание (файл PDF)

Дуг Тидуэлл

     1

электронная книга Лучший выбор


Издательство: Символ-Плюс
Дата выхода: ноябрь 2009
Размер файла: 6769 Кб
Место в рейтинге продаж: 291

Книга "XSLT, 2-е издание" написана известным специалистом по XML. Ее цель - научить читателя эффективно использовать XSLT. Рассматриваются как XSLT 1.0, так и XSLT 2.0, а также версии 1.0 и 2.0 языка XPath. В спецификации XSLT 2.0 язык был дополнен рядом важных возможностей, многие из которых связаны с изменениями в XPath 2.0. Эти два языка проектировались в расчете на совместное использование: XPath определяет преобразуемые части документа XML, а XSLT указывает, как должно быть выполнено преобразование.
В начальных главах рассматриваются основы XSLT, в том числе простые таблицы стилей и настройка процессоров, особое внимание уделяется преобразованиям на базе шаблонов, обсуждаются основные концепции XPath 1.0 и 2.0. Вы узнаете, как в XSLT 2.0 интегрирована поддержка XML Schema, научитесь определять элементы и типы данных и использовать их в своих таблицах стилей. В завершающих главах рассматриваются примеры, в которых задействованы все возможности XSLT и XPath. Вы увидите, как одна и та же задача решается в XSLT 1.0 и 2.0, что поможет решить, какая версия лучше всего подходит для вашего проекта. Вторая часть книги содержит приложения, в которых приводятся сотни таблиц стилей, в том числе примеры для каждого элемента, функции и оператора, определяемых в XSLT и XPath.
Во всех главах книги представлены решения стандартных задач, в которых XSLT проявляет свои чрезвычайно мощные и полезные возможности. Применение XSLT 2.0 во многих случаях существенно упрощает жизнь программиста. Книга написана как учебник для тех, кто начинает изучать XSLT, а опытные специалисты смогут использовать ее как справочник по функциям и различным аспектам языка.

Об авторах

Дуг Тидуэлл работает ведущим программистом в IBM. Занимается программированием более 15 лет, а с языками разметки работает более 10. Он выступал еще на первой конференции SGML/XML в 1997 году, ведет семинары по XML во многих странах мира. Тидуэлл видит свою миссию "кибер-проповедника" в том, чтобы помогать людям решать задачи с помощью новых технологий. Получил степень магистра в области информационных технологий в Университете Вандербильта, а также степень бакалавра по английскому языку в Университете штата Джорджия. Живет в Роли, Северная Каролина, с женой и дочерью Лили.